And the explosion of young Nordic talent continues - and continues to impress - with Original, the debut feature from film making duo Antonio Tublén And Alexander Brøndsted. We've long held the position that Anders Thomas Jensen unofficial position of 'Lost Nordic Coen Brother' but it looks like he's about to have some competition for that title ...

Henry tries hard to blend in. Most of his life, he has been acting the human chameleon, which has turned him into a pale reflection of other people's expectations. One day, after having brutally failed and crashed straight into reality, Henry's best friend Jon talks him into opening a restaurant with him in Spain. Goodbye rain and depression, hello tapas and sangria! Before leaving, though, Henry needs to fix a few things: kidnap his mother from a mental institution, find love in a king-size bed in IKEA, and uncover the truth about his best friend. But nothing turns out as expected, and Henry is caught up in a maelstrom of strange events. Could it be so that he is an original rather than invisible?

The full trailer and an extended scene for this have turned up online and both are very impressive. The trailer shows off the tone of the film in all it's glory while the clip - raw around the edges and clearly not yet through the color correction process - features a hysterical turn by Tuva Novotny as a hyper-aggressive, neo-feminist art-punk stripper.
